In June, COVID-19 Trended Younger
The number of confirmed COVID-19 cases in Virginia has declined in the last month.
7-Day Average of Reported Cases in Virginia.

However, a greater portion of cases reported in June involved young people.
Percent of cases that are people under 30
March through May

June

One thing hasn't changed: Young people who are infected with COVID-19 are less likely to require hospitalization.
